Changed defaults for the Brightfern clinic reminder job (v2.9). Heads up, future maintainers: the job now sends reminders 48 hours out instead of 24, after the Oakhollow pilot showed fewer no-shows. Quiet hours are respected by default, and SMS retries dropped from five to two because carriers were flagging us. If you need the old behavior, override it per-tenant. The job ships with the following default configuration values.

config for yajef-tajof:
[belius]
host = belius.crelvolabs.internal
user = belius_svc
database = belius_prod

// Broker upgrade notes for plugin authors:
// Quillbus 4.x replaces the legacy 3.x wire protocol. Plugins must
// construct the client with explicit protocol negotiation enabled,
// or connections to the Larkfield cluster will be silently downgraded
// and dropped after 30s. Topic names are unchanged. For local testing
// against the sandbox broker, authenticate with the key below.

API key for bafof-bagaf: qvz2-qi

# Building Access — Holiday Opening Hours

Pellbury Hall runs reduced hours over the holiday period. Reception is staffed 08:00–16:00 on working days only; closed on public holidays. Deliveries go to the loading bay before 14:00. The café and gym are shut throughout. Staff needing access outside staffed hours must pre-book via the facilities rota and enter through the west door. Outside staffed hours the west door requires the code below.

turnstile pass: bdg-NNMWFJ-69474011

Handover — Licensing Dispute, Ferncroft Instruments

Branch managers: I'm passing the Ferncroft licensing matter to Director Halveson effective Monday. Counsel has rejected their second settlement draft; royalty terms remain the sticking point. Do not discuss the dispute with Ferncroft field reps. All correspondence routes through Halveson's office. Timeline and fallback position are unchanged. The confidential note below sets out our negotiating plans.

board note of tawig-bajof: The renewal with Ralixix Holdings closes at $10 million a year, 20 percent above the last contract. Project Druix slips by two quarters because of the tooling delay.

TURN-208: Gatevale turnstile counters at the Merrow Field pilot double-count when a rotation reverses mid-cycle. Attendance totals drift roughly 2% high per event. The debounce window fix is implemented, reviewed by Ilsa, and soak-tested across two simulated match days without drift. Ready for your cut; the candidate build is identified below.

trace token, tagag-tafog: htk6_5ed18c